Weather in Florianopolis: A Year-Round Overview

Florianopolis enjoys a subtropical climate characterized by warm temperatures and ample sunshine throughout the year. However, the island experiences distinct seasons, each with its unique charm and weather patterns. Understanding these variations is key to making an informed decision about when to visit.

Summer (December to March): The Peak Season

Summer in Florianopolis is synonymous with balmy temperatures, crystal-clear waters, and vibrant energy. Average highs range from 28°C to 32°C (82°F to 90°F), while lows hover around 20°C to 24°C (68°F to 75°F). The humidity is high, and rainfall is relatively low, making it ideal for beach days, swimming, and water sports.

This is the peak tourist season, so expect higher prices and larger crowds, especially during the festive period of December and January. If you prefer a more relaxed atmosphere, consider visiting in February or early March when the crowds start to thin out.

Autumn (April to June): Shoulder Season Delight

Autumn in Florianopolis offers a pleasant respite from the summer crowds while still boasting comfortable temperatures. Average highs range from 22°C to 26°C (72°F to 79°F), and lows dip to around 15°C to 19°C (59°F to 66°F). Rainfall increases slightly, but sunny days are still plentiful. This shoulder season is a great time to enjoy outdoor activities without the summer heat and throngs of tourists.

Winter (July to September): A Cooler Escape

Winter in Florianopolis is mild compared to other parts of Brazil. Average highs range from 18°C to 22°C (64°F to 72°F), and lows drop to around 12°C to 16°C (54°F to 61°F). Rainfall is at its highest during this period, but showers are usually brief and followed by sunshine. While swimming might not be as appealing, winter offers a cozy atmosphere for exploring the island’s charming towns, indulging in local cuisine, and enjoying cultural events. Spring (October to November): A Time of Renewal

Spring in Florianopolis marks a period of renewal and vibrant colors. Average highs range from 20°C to 24°C (68°F to 75°F), and lows hover around 16°C to 20°C (61°F to 68°F). Rainfall gradually decreases, and the days become longer and sunnier. Spring is a beautiful time to witness the island’s flora in full bloom and enjoy outdoor activities.

Crowd Levels and Prices

Understanding crowd levels and prices is crucial for planning your trip and ensuring a comfortable experience. Here’s a general overview:

Peak Season (December to March):

Expect the highest prices and largest crowds during the summer months, especially around Christmas and New Year’s. Accommodation, flights, and tours will be more expensive, and popular attractions and beaches will be busier.

Shoulder Seasons (April to June and October to November):

The shoulder seasons offer a good balance between pleasant weather and manageable crowds. Prices are generally lower than peak season, and you’ll encounter fewer tourists.

Off-Season (July to September):
